Great facilitation doesn’t end with conceptual clarity. Its true test is in enabling learners to apply what they’ve learned in their real-world roles. This interactive session uses the Situational Leadership model to demonstrate how customised tools can bridge the gap between insight and action. Through a mix of insight-triggering gameplay and hands-on design, participants will discover how to make learning stick by mapping concepts directly to workplace realities.
Session Objectives
1. Design session to close application gap – Understand the gap between concept immersion and enabling application in a real-world context, and integrate strategies to close it into the session design.
2. Experience context-mapping tools in action – Engage in a brief gameplay experience to generate insights, then work with a customised Situational Leadership tool that helps each participant connect the model’s principles directly to their facilitation reality.
3. Begin creating personalised application-focused tools – Learn a simple framework for designing facilitation tools that drive actionable, role-relevant outcomes for any learning program.
